+"""
+SNMPv2c
++++++++
+
+Send SNMP GET request using the following options:
+
+ * with SNMPv2c, community 'public'
+ * over IPv4/UDP with non-default timeout and no retries
+ * to an Agent at demo.snmplabs.com:161
+ * for two instances of SNMPv2-MIB::sysDescr.0 MIB object,
+ * based on Twisted I/O framework
+
+Functionally similar to:
+
+| $ snmpget -v2c -c public -r 0 -t 2 demo.snmplabs.com SNMPv2-MIB::sysDescr.0
+
+"""#
+from twisted.internet.task import react
+from pysnmp.hlapi.twisted import *
+
+def success((errorStatus, errorIndex, varBinds), hostname):
+ if errorStatus:
+ print('%s: %s at %s' % (
+ hostname,
+ errorStatus.prettyPrint(),
+ errorIndex and varBinds[int(errorIndex)-1][0] or '?'
+ )
+ )
+ else:
+ for varBind in varBinds:
+ print(' = '.join([ x.prettyPrint() for x in varBind ]))
+
+def failure(errorIndication, hostname):
+ print('%s failure: %s' % (hostname, errorIndication))
+
+def getSysDescr(reactor, hostname):
+ snmpEngine = SnmpEngine()
+
+ d = getCmd(snmpEngine,
+ CommunityData('public'),
+ UdpTransportTarget((hostname, 161), timeout=2.0, retries=0),
+ ContextData(),
+ ObjectType(ObjectIdentity('SNMPv2-MIB', 'sysDescr', 0)))
+
+ d.addCallback(success, hostname).addErrback(failure, hostname)
+
+ return d
+
+react(getSysDescr, ['demo.snmplabs.com'])
